QUOTE(ThEbOrEdBoY @ Aug 12 2011, 09:40 PM) Thr r no noise canceling earphone tat is below 300? Added on August 12, 2011, 9:47 pmN can i noe wat's the meanin is isolation?i dun realli noe..thx... To summarize it, cancellation is active while isolation is passive. Most of the IEMs have isolation, when u put it into ur ears u don't listen much noises from outside. Noise cancellation wise, it will produce a low humming sound (anti-noise signal to be exact) to block all the noise from outside so that u can enjoy ur music in plane, train, etc.
